About this app

A true and totally 3D app for studying human anatomy, built on an advanced interactive 3D touch interface.

Features:
★ You can rotate models to any angles and zoom in and out
★ Remove structures to reveal the anatomical structures below them.
★ 3D location quizzes to test your knowledge
★ Switch on/off different anatomy systems
★ Both male and female reproductive systems are available
★ Support Spanish, French, German, Polish, Russian, Portuguese, Chinese and Japanese.

Contents:
★ Bones
★ Ligaments
★ Joints
★ Muscles
★ Circulation (arteries, vein and heart)
★ Central nervous system
★ Peripheral nervous system
★ Sense organs
★ Respiratory
★ Digestive
★ Urinary
★ Reproductive ( both male and female)
